Simple Habits for a Cleaner Living Room
 - Declutter Daily 
 Mess attracts more mess. If your coffee table is full of random stuff, chances are, it’ll stay that way. Take a minute each day to put things back in their place.
 
 - Dust and Wipe Surfaces 
 You’d be surprised how fast dust builds up. Use a microfiber cloth to wipe down tables, shelves, and TV stands. For glass surfaces, a vinegar-and-water mix works wonders.
 
 - Vacuum Regularly 
 Carpets and rugs collect dirt, hair, and crumbs like nobody’s business. A quick vacuum twice a week keeps them fresh. Got pets? A HEPA-filter vacuum is a game-changer.
 
 - Keep Things Organized 
 When everything has a place, cleaning is easier. Use baskets for small items, keep remotes in one spot, and don’t let random things pile up.
 
 - Don’t Forget Electronics 
 Dust and fingerprints love TV screens and remotes. A simple wipe-down with a microfiber cloth keeps them looking clean and germ-free.

2. Getting Rid of Carpet Smells
If you’ve ever wondered how can I remove urine smell from carpet, the trick is using enzyme cleaners. They break down the odor at its source. Sprinkling baking soda overnight and vacuuming in the morning also helps. Steam cleaning? Even better. According to the Carpet and Rug Institute, steam cleaning is the best way to sanitize carpets (source: Carpet and Rug Institute).
3. Improve Air Quality
A clean living room should smell fresh too! Open windows for fresh air, and add air-purifying plants like peace lilies. NASA even did a study showing that certain plants help remove toxins from indoor air (source: NASA).
4. Don’t Ignore Light Fixtures and Fans
Ceiling fans and light fixtures collect dust fast. Wipe them down monthly to keep dust from spreading through the air.
5. Wash Soft Furnishings
Cushions, blankets, and curtains collect odors and dust. Washing them regularly makes a huge difference.
Preventing Dirt and Stains
 - Use Rugs and Doormats 
 A good doormat stops dirt before it gets inside. Rugs in high-traffic areas also help keep floors cleaner.
 
 - Protect Your Furniture 
 A fabric protector spray helps repel stains on sofas and chairs. Brands like Scotchgard create a barrier that makes spills easier to clean (source: 3M Scotchgard).

Easy Cleaning Schedule to Follow
 - Daily: Pick up clutter, wipe down tables, and fluff cushions. 
 
 - Weekly: Vacuum, dust furniture, and mop the floors. 
 
 - Monthly: Wash pillow covers, deep clean rugs, and disinfect remotes. 
 
 - Quarterly: Get your sofa and carpets professionally cleaned, wash curtains, and check for any needed repairs. 
 
 - Yearly: Refresh furniture, repaint walls if needed, and update worn-out decor.
